Output 83c1e2d92ebc3b365d71799c1243540ec627d2eaed7a777682c11f3ce71cda8e:77

value
430525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af9bc2fa677d949d78433754845a30b6db6d9b6 OP_EQUAL
address
374rHZxQPUZNzVhjvdy3muL6kX5F1Vr3Je
transaction
83c1e2d92ebc3b365d71799c1243540ec627d2eaed7a777682c11f3ce71cda8e
spent
true